What Should You Do if You Are Thin ?CIMAGINE A classroom missing one thing that has long been considered a necessary part to reading and writing? Paper. No notebooks , no textbooks, no test paper. Nor are there any pencils or pens, which always seem to run out of ink at the critical(關(guān)鍵的) moment.Students don’t any handwriting in this class. Instead, they use palm(手掌) size, or specially designed puters. The teacher downloads texts from Internet libraries and sends them to every student’s personal puter.Having puters also means that students can use the Web . They can look up information on any subject they’re studying ! High school teacher Judy Harrell in Florida, US, described how her class used the Web to learn about the war in Afghanistan over one year ago.“We could touch every side of the country through different sites, from the forest to refugee camps(難民營(yíng)) ,” she said . “ Using a book that’s three or four years old is impossible.”A paperless classroom is a big step towards reducing the waste of paper . High school teacher Stephanie Sorrell in Kentucky, US, said she used to give 900 pieces of paper each week to each student.But, with all this technology, there’s always the risk that the machines will break down. So, in case of a power failure or technical problems, paper textbooks are still widely available for these hitech students.43.
